Its all in the presentation.......



Spicy gizzard served in a white shell and draped with pearls


Pasta salad served in martini glasses and garnished with cherry tomatoes


Coconut shrimp served on a bed of lettuce and garnished with plantain chips

Pineapple meatballs garnished with rose petals and pebbles

We are going to take a break from looking at some of my past events and talk about food.

Gosh i love good food! (who doesn't right? lolll). I love to make it, eat it and most importantly SERVE IT!. I have always believed that its not always about serving the most expensive food but rather HOW YOU SERVE IT!. I am known for my crazy, sometimes over-d-top, unique ways of presenting food and can have you believing a simple burger is just as fancy as Fillet Mignon.
Why should good 'ol American Mac-n-Cheese just be considered comfort food, when you can make it soo much more. I am always thinking up ways to incorporate things that i know will WOW the guests, "my little conversational pieces" i like to call them. When you present food in a unique and creative way, you can get the average person who usually wouldn't try something new, actually give it a go. So the next time you want to entertain your guests, surprise them by presenting food in a way they have never seen before. Believe me , they won't soon forget the experience.
